well ok, i dunno about quakerism or christianity. see, quakerism is usually thought of as a branch of christianity. now, christianity is based on the teachings of jesus christ and this book called the bible with 2 testaments, the old and new testament, and the old testament is also called the torah and it is the basis for the older religion of judaism. quakerism was established by george fox in england in the 1600’s because he was dissatisfied with the way other christians practiced their religion and thought they had lost the way and were no longer practicing things the way early christians did, in the first and second century a.d. george fox believed that the early christians had a superior form of christianity which had been wiped out by the corruption of the roman empire, when the romans made christianity their official state religion, and established the vatican in rome with the pope as its leader. he thought that catholicism was horrible and that protestants had made good strides in reforming christianity but had still not gone far enough in getting back to the true spirit of christianity. so, thus, quakerism was established. nowadays, some quakers do not consider themselves christians, and they have other beliefs, but are still welcome to practice quakerism.
